A home warranty is a service contract that covers major appliances and built-in home systems as they break down due to normal wear and tear. Securing a home warranty for your rental property ensures that your investment is protected against expensive maintenance issues at all times.
Because plenty of landlords live far away from their investment properties, it can be difficult to track down a reputable service technician in the area for a fair rate. Having a home warranty for their rental properties grants landlords access to prompt and affordable service professionals without needing to be present. Here’s a step-by-step for how this would work:
Landlords and real estate investors have a unique advantage when it comes to financing premiums because rental home warranties are tax-deductible. So long as your rental property is not owner-occupied and generates steady cash flow, your home warranty premium can be written off as an operating expense.

Tenants can’t purchase a home warranty for the property they’re renting. Still, renters insurance is always an alternative option for anyone needing individual coverage for their belongings while leasing your home.
Yes! Home warranties on rental properties are considered an operating expense, and therefore can be claimed and deducted from your taxes.
Home insurance for rental properties differs greatly from a home warranty. Rental property owners will typically invest in landlord insurance, which protects damage to rental properties from wind, fire, and other covered disasters.
Landlords cannot purchase the typical homeowners insurance policy as they do not live in the house. Most landlords have Landlord insurance and require their tenants to have rental insurance as well.
A home warranty for rental property will only offer coverage on normal wear and tear on the properties home appliances and systems. This type of contract will not cover damage from natural disasters.
Home warranties can be purchased for all types of homes, including condos, apartments, mobile homes, single- and multi-family homes. The only variance may be cost, as some policies will be cheaper if the square footage is smaller.
